LMI is seeking a ServiceNow Developer to support customer configuration and development. The role involves translating business requirements into ServiceNow solutions, optimizing performance, and creating data visualizations to track KPIs. They focus on accelerating government impact with innovation and speed.

Requirements

  • At least 5 years of demonstrated experience in development, implementation and deployment of ServiceNow modules using Agile DevSecOps techniques in a client environment
  • Strong expertise in ServiceNow Performance Analytics (PA)
  • Experience in designing and implementing data collection jobs, formula indicators, and automated trend analysis
  • Experience creating and optimizing Performance Analytics scorecards to track KPIs
  • Hands-on experience with ServiceNow reporting, data visualization, and analytics leveraging the Performance Analytics module
  • Knowledge of ServiceNow data structures and how PA integrates with other modules (e.g., GRC, ITSM, CSM, HRSD)
  • Experience in Scripting (JavaScript, Glide API, or Business Rules)
  • Ability to obtain and maintain a public trust/background investigation
